APS switchover impact on statistics

All SAP-level statistics are retained with an APS switch. A SAP reflects the data received regardless of the number of APS switches that has occurred. ATM statistics, however, are cleared after an APS switch. Therefore, any ATM statistics viewed on an APS port are only the statistics since the current active member port became active.

Physical layer packet statistics on the APS group reflect what is currently on the active member port.

Port and path-level statistics follow the same behavior as described above.

Any SONET physical-layer statistics (for example, B1,B2,B3,...) on the APS port are only what is current on the active APS member port.
